On Friday evening, a large fire broke out at Maripharm, a laboratory for medicinal cannabis in Rotterdam. Part of the façade had to be demolished during the extinguishing works, but this made it possible to preserve another part of the building. As far as it is known, no one was injured, the NOS reports.
